Stories at Work by Indranil Chakraborty emphasizes the power of storytelling in the workplace and its potential to transform communication and leadership. Through this book, Chakraborty demonstrates how telling effective, well-structured stories can help professionals communicate their ideas, build trust, and influence others, especially in environments where technical and data-driven discussions are prevalent.

For working professionals in technical fields, Stories at Work provides valuable insights into how to move beyond dry facts and numbers and engage colleagues, clients, or teams by presenting ideas in a more compelling and relatable manner. The book emphasizes that storytelling isn’t just for marketers or creatives but is a skill that can enhance anyone’s ability to lead and collaborate effectively. Chakraborty argues that stories can help convey complex technical concepts in a way that resonates emotionally and intellectually with the audience, fostering connection and understanding.

One powerful lesson from the book is the concept of “story weaving” — a technique where professionals weave stories into their day-to-day communication to create memorable experiences for others. Whether you’re pitching a new project idea or explaining a technical process, integrating storytelling can make your message more impactful. Another important lesson is how stories can shape an organization’s culture and values, creating a shared sense of purpose among team members. By tapping into emotions, storytelling fosters a more engaged, motivated workforce, especially in settings where technical professionals often struggle to connect on a personal level.

Chakraboty’s Stories at Work provides technical professionals with a strategic advantage, offering them tools to not only improve their communication but also to inspire, influence, and lead through the art of storytelling.
